On paved roads, the 2026 Jeep Grand Cherokee near Akron emphasizes smoothness and control. The suspension is tuned to absorb common imperfections like expansion joints, patched sections, and potholes, helping the vehicle stay composed and reducing jolts felt by occupants.
Steering feedback is generally calibrated to be confident at highway speeds, supporting relaxed lane changes and stable tracking over long stretches. For commuters who regularly drive I‑77, I‑76, or Route 18, this focus on stability and comfort can make a noticeable difference in day‑to‑day driving satisfaction.
Life in and around Akron often includes driving on road surfaces that are less than perfect. Gravel lanes, rural routes, and weather‑affected pavement are common across northeast Ohio. The 2026 Jeep Grand Cherokee near Akron is built with those conditions in mind.
With solid ground clearance and a robust suspension setup, the Grand Cherokee can maintain composure over uneven surfaces and moderate obstacles without feeling fragile. Available all‑wheel‑drive systems and terrain‑management features further enhance its ability to handle loose surfaces, inclines, and light off‑road excursions, making it a practical choice for drivers who occasionally venture beyond the main roads.

For many buyers, safety is a top priority when choosing a 2026 Jeep Grand Cherokee near Akron. Recent models are typically equipped with a broad set of active and passive features designed to help prevent accidents and protect occupants in the event of a collision.
Depending on the configuration, systems may include:
Forward‑collision warning with automatic emergency braking assistance
Lane‑departure alerts and lane‑keeping support
Blind‑spot monitoring and rear cross‑traffic alerts to assist with lane changes and backing out of parking spaces
Adaptive cruise control to help maintain set following distances on highways
These technologies are meant to assist rather than replace the driver, but they can be particularly helpful during busy commutes, low‑visibility conditions, or longer drives across Ohio.
